Akshar, the Hyderabad-based rock band, is at its best when it brings its regional element into play. Producing music covers of popular film numbers in Telugu and Hindi, their strength is the alternative spin they give to conventional music. Having performed twice in the city last week at Klub Trinity and Heart Cup, the five-member band comprising Manmohan Raj (lead vocals/rhythm guitar), Surabit Haflongbar (bass guitar), Dill (lead guitars), Gopal Sahis (keyboard) and Aaron Wesley (drum set) came together four years ago for an annual fest at BITS Pilani, Hyderabad and ended up winning it. As winners, they got to perform with the popular Pakistani band Strings in front of a crowd that numbered a thousand and that was indeed a big leap.
During their journey of performing at several university shows and corporate events, there’ve been interesting instances of crowd acclaim.
The most satisfying one for them was at a Doctor’s conference held at The Park, the previous year. “We were wondering if the occasion was too official for our kind of music. But, seeing all the leading doctors across the city head-banging to our act made our day,” Manmohan Raj reminisces.
The vocalist talking on their brand of music says their intent has always been to cater to normal people over music enthusiasts. “Our aim has been to give a layman, a better musical connect and offer them a unique experience. That’s one reason we’ve done covers of popular songs including the melodic metal version of ‘Oh Papa Lali’, the rock version of ‘Anando Brahma’ while adding our stamp to the Agent Vinod song ‘Raabta’ as well.”
And their work was good enough to earn acclaim from Akkineni Nagarjuna himself. Manmohan insists that the covers of these film numbers are only a stepping stone to reach out to people and that they do have originals coming up for the future.
